Espresso Martini

1 oz cold espresso
1 1/2 oz vodka
1 1/2 oz Kahlua coffee liqueur
1 oz white creme de cacao
3 Coffee beans (for garnish)

Pour ingredients into shaker filled with ice, shake vigorously, and strain into chilled martini glass. Garnish with coffee beans. Best sipped during a ROWYCO playlist. Pinkies up.

Cambridge BYOB Ordinance Starts March 31st


The City of Cambridge Bring Your Own Bag (BYOB) Ordinance takes effect March 31st, 2016 and affects retail establishments that provide a checkout bag to customers at the point of sale. Retail establishments such as grocery and convenience stores, pharmacies, restaurants, liquor stores, and other retailers must comply with this ordinance.

The purpose of the Ordinance is to reduce the use of disposable checkout bags by retail establishments. Under the ordinance, plastic bags with handles are prohibited. Any reusable, paper, or compostable bag with handles provided at the point of sale must charge a checkout bag charge minimum of $0.10/bag. Businesses must show this as the “Checkout Bag Charge” on the receipt and collect sales tax on each bag. Bags exempt from the Ordinance include produce bags, laundry, dry-cleaner and newspaper bags, and bags used to wrap meat or frozen foods.

Mercury on Mars Joins Ocelot Records

Grab your copy of 'Be The One' for free on Bandcamp now.

Mercury On Mars has joined up with Ocelot Records for their latest album due out this summer. The 2015 Rock ‘n’ Roll Rumble band is offering their 2014 release ‘Be The Onefor free on Bandcamp in celebration of the partnership.

Ocelot Records will be working with the alt-rock band to release their new album and to bring a back-catalog of albums into the future with streaming services such as Spotify, Apple, Amazon, Google, Youtube and more.

Mercury On Mars joins a growing list of acts on the Ocelot label including fellow 2015 Rumble band Psychic Dog, two current #classof2016 Rumblers, The Digs and Idle Pilot, and Boston Music Award winner DCDR. Blueberry Mint Fizz

(Originally posted on FoodShouldTasteGood.com)
  • 12 blueberries
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lime juice
  • 5 mint leaves
  • 1 oz gin
  • 1/2 cup gingerale
  • ice
  • lime wedge for garnish

Add blueberries, mint, and lime juice to a glass and muddle ingredients together. Then add gin and ice, and top it off with the ginger ale. Add lime wedge for garnish. Tastes good with with lime tortilla chips and this playlist.
